Encryption Clase
Configuración de cifrado en la cuenta de almacenamiento.
Todos los parámetros necesarios deben rellenarse para enviarlos a Azure.
- Herencia
-
azure.mgmt.storage._serialization.ModelEncryption
Constructor
Encryption(*, key_source: str | _models.KeySource = 'Microsoft.Storage', services: _models.EncryptionServices | None = None, require_infrastructure_encryption: bool | None = None, key_vault_properties: _models.KeyVaultProperties | None = None, **kwargs: Any)
Parámetros de solo palabra clave
Nombre | Description |
---|---|
services
|
Lista de servicios que admiten el cifrado. |
key_source
|
KeySource (proveedor) de cifrado. Valores posibles (sin distinción entre mayúsculas y minúsculas): Microsoft.Storage, Microsoft.Keyvault. Los valores conocidos son: "Microsoft.Storage" y "Microsoft.Keyvault". valor predeterminado: Microsoft.Storage
|
require_infrastructure_encryption
|
Valor booleano que indica si el servicio aplica o no una capa secundaria de cifrado con claves administradas por la plataforma para los datos en reposo. |
key_vault_properties
|
Propiedades proporcionadas por el almacén de claves. |
Variables
Nombre | Description |
---|---|
services
|
Lista de servicios que admiten el cifrado. |
key_source
|
KeySource (proveedor) de cifrado. Valores posibles (sin distinción entre mayúsculas y minúsculas): Microsoft.Storage, Microsoft.Keyvault. Los valores conocidos son: "Microsoft.Storage" y "Microsoft.Keyvault". |
require_infrastructure_encryption
|
Valor booleano que indica si el servicio aplica o no una capa secundaria de cifrado con claves administradas por la plataforma para los datos en reposo. |
key_vault_properties
|
Propiedades proporcionadas por el almacén de claves. |
Azure SDK for Python